Unlike old-school software (e.g., AutoCAD 2007), Fusion 360 stores designs, toolpaths, and simulation results on Autodesk’s cloud servers. The local client constantly phones home to verify your license. A crack would have to spoof Autodesk’s authentication servers AND block telemetry without breaking the software’s core functionality. This is a cat-and-mouse game where Autodesk patches exploits every month.
